The Historic Town of Amalfi
As part of your yacht charter review, I have to mention the included visit to the town of Amalfi itself. This ancient maritime republic was once one of the most powerful trading centres in the Mediterranean, and its glory days are still evident in the stunning Duomo di Amalfi that dominates the town square. Wandering the narrow streets, you’ll discover artisan paper shops, limoncello producers, and authentic family-run restaurants serving the freshest seafood imaginable.

What to Wear: Comfortable swimwear with a cover-up is ideal. Bring a light jacket even in summer, as the sea breeze can be refreshing when the boat is moving. Flat-soled shoes or boat shoes are recommended for safety.
Seasickness Considerations: The waters along the Amalfi Coast are generally calm, especially in summer months. However, if you’re prone to motion sickness, consider taking preventive medication before departure. The enclosed bays and coves provide natural protection from any swells.

Weather Considerations: The Amalfi Coast enjoys a Mediterranean climate with hot, dry summers and mild winters. The sailing season typically runs from April through October, with peak conditions from June through September. Peak Season (June-August): The most popular time to visit, with guaranteed warm weather and perfect swimming conditions. However, expect more boats on the water and busier towns when you stop ashore. Book your yacht charter review experience well in advance during these months.
Shoulder Season (April-May, September-October): My personal favourite time for this best Italy yacht charter. The weather remains warm enough for swimming, the crowds thin considerably, and the light takes on a gorgeous golden quality. September, in particular, offers water temperatures that have been warming all summer.
